Cryptographic Validity Proofs

Cryptography

Cryptographic Validity Proofs, within the context of cryptocurrency, options trading, and financial derivatives, represent a paradigm shift in establishing the integrity and authenticity of on-chain and off-chain data. These proofs leverage zero-knowledge or succinct verifiable computation techniques to demonstrate the correctness of a computation without revealing the underlying data or the computation itself. This capability is particularly valuable in scenarios demanding privacy and scalability, such as decentralized finance (DeFi) protocols and complex derivative pricing models. The core principle involves generating a compact proof that a specific calculation, like a complex options valuation, was performed correctly, bolstering trust in the system.
